Falling for You

Romantic Homemade Thanksgiving Card Materials

Paper

Real leaves

Speedball ink

Palette or paper
 plates

Cloth or scrap paper

Declare your love in a new romance, and capture that falling in love feeling with romantic Thanksgiving card. Collect a couple of different shapes of leaves from a variety of deciduous trees. Brush dirt and debris off the leaves using a soft, dry paint brush.

Press the leaves lightly by placing them between two pieces of wax paper and putting them in a big book like the dictionary or a phone book. After a day, when the leaf has flattened, you can use it to make a romantic Thanksgiving card.

Squeeze out some red Speedball ink on a linoleum block, a plastic palette or even a piece of glass. You will also need some yellow ink and some orange ink. Because this is a romantic Thanksgiving card, its okay to use a lot of red.

Press a leaf into the red ink, lifting the color. Using the stem to gently lift off the leaf. Press the leaf onto a piece of cloth to remove the excess ink. Tip: you can make Thanksgiving Day place mats or decorate a plain tablecloth at the same time.

Use the leaf to make a leaf print on the paper. Repeat the process with more leaves and more colors. Let the romantic Thanksgivng card dry completely.

Inside the card write, "I'm falling for you!"

I've Never Felt So Happy

Romantic Homemade Thanksgiving Card Materials

Fancy stationary paper or velvet craft paper

Felt

Glue

Make a romantic Thanksgiving card using tactile materials including black velvet paper (found in fine arts stores) and pieces of felt. The entire card should stimulate the sense of touch. Think of soft materials that can be used in the card, including craft felt, feathers and even faux fur from the craft aisle, if that fits your style.

Inside write, "I've Never Felt So Happy! I love You!"
